University Clinical Center of Kosovo Launches New Digital Birth Registration Service
The University Clinical Center of Kosovo (UCCK) is introducing a new digital service for the registration of births, commencing at the Gynecology Clinic. The initiative is designed to streamline the process for citizens seeking to formally record births, offering a more efficient and expedited method compared to traditional procedures. According to a recent press release, the launch reflects a commitment to improved administrative processes within the healthcare system.
The new service will be accessible directly within the Gynecology Clinic of the UCCK.
